When the news reached the general's manor, Ren Tianye was arranging the betrothal gifts.
Under the arrangement of Su Jin, the mole within the Su family, the betrothal gifts for the Su family's second miss, Su Xiu, were prepared one by one.
Ren Tianye was not a stingy man; everything was arranged abundantly according to custom.
The process was still handled by Su Jin and Deputy General Wang Ming.
Just as he had sent the two to deliver the betrothal gifts, a messenger brought bad news.
"Report! Great General, ten miles outside Yunji City, a unit of the imperial court's Imperial Guard is approaching at top speed. They number about twenty thousand, with complete formations and formidable military might."
Ren Tianye's body jolted.
The imperial court had already sent people?
So fast!
His palms could not help but sweat slightly.
Although he now had over seven thousand elite soldiers under his command, entirely under his control and answering only to his orders...
...the Great Yu Dynasty had been established for eight hundred years. Even a centipede does not die when crushed.
Moreover, the current Great Yu Dynasty was at the height of its prime.
If calculated by military strength alone, just their standing army could muster hundreds of thousands of troops.
It was simply not something he could resist.
And the Imperial Guard that came this time was known as the most elite in the country. Although their true combat power might not match the annihilated Chifeng Army, a great reputation is not built on nothing. The strength of the Imperial Guard still put immense pressure on him.
"Let's go take a look."
Ren Tianye left the manor, mounted his Night-Illuminating Jade Lion, and galloped straight toward the walls of Yunji City amid the clatter of hooves.
As soon as he ascended the wall, Sun Xiang and Zhang Shi gathered around him.
"What is the situation?"
"Reporting to the Great General, scouts continue to send reports, but right now, we haven't seen the Imperial Guard yet."
Ren Tianye looked out past Yunji City.
He couldn't see anything either.
In fact, the naked human eye can see large targets at a considerable distance, such as mountains, city outlines, and rivers.
Twenty thousand Imperial Guards was not a small target.
They should be visible.
Especially since they were standing on high ground.
However, Yunji City had a flaw.
Built surrounded by mountains on three sides, the area not far below it was covered with dense thorns and low hills, which easily concealed lines of sight.
Making it so that no matter how he looked now, there was no trace of them.
But he still immediately ordered, "Assemble the soldiers, enter a state of high alert."
"Yes!"
Zhang Shi immediately went to pass the order.
Sun Xiang stayed with Ren Tianye on the walls of Yunji City, waiting for the impending arrival of the Imperial Guard.
The reports from the scouts came swiftly and frantically.
"Report! The Imperial Guard is eight miles away!"
"Report! The Imperial Guard is seven miles away!"
"Report! The Imperial Guard has reached six miles away!"
"Report! The Imperial Guard has reached five miles away!"
...
In wartime, the frequency of scout reports was much higher than usual, not to mention the unique terrain of Yunji City necessitated constant updates.
But the rhythm of these reports made Ren Tianye, Sun Xiang, and the many soldiers on the wall look grave.
Everyone clearly and intuitively perceived one thing.
"The Imperial Guard is so fast!"
"Are they trying to fight a blitzkrieg?"
Ren Tianye squeezed out a bit of cold sweat.
However, he did not panic.
After all, Yunji City had been fortified by Zhan Shubai to be comparable to Shanhe City; in terms of defense alone, it was even more fearsome than Shanhe City.
Although twenty thousand Imperial Guards were extraordinary, wanting to instantly breach Yunji City was pure delusion.
Furthermore...
The soldiers from the tents inside the city had also taken their positions one after another.
Each and every one of them glared with rage, their eyes practically splitting.
"The Empress really wants to kill us!"
"Damn it, those treacherous officials in the court won't leave us a single way out."
"Fortunately, General Ren is willing to protect us, otherwise, today would be our dead end."
"Fuck! I'm going all out. Even if I have to die, I'll drag two down with me."
...
The soldiers' morale was soaring.
This made Ren Tianye feel even more reassured. Then, at the very edge of his vision, he saw an army surging forward, kicking up clouds of dust that billowed and swirled, their momentum awe-inspiring.
At this distance, the naked eye could not see details, but based on his understanding of the Imperial Guard, Ren Tianye quickly made a judgment.
The patterns on their chests should be the Black Bird totem, and they all wore helmets bearing the character for Black.
Presumably, they were also equipped with Black character waist tags.
"The Imperial Guard!"
"The Imperial Guard that protects the Forbidden City!"
"It seems these are the very people who massacred the seventy thousand Chifeng Army."
"So..."
Ren Tianye guessed: "Did they slaughter the Chifeng Army and then, upon learning of our rebellion, receive orders to immediately come and exterminate us?"
"I wonder who is commanding the Imperial Guard. This battlefield acuity and decisiveness in action are quite remarkable."
"However..."
"Twenty thousand Imperial Guards might not be enough!"
Ren Tianye's gaze grew increasingly focused and solid.
Once the twenty thousand Imperial Guards entered his line of sight, the advantages of Yunji City were fully unleashed.
Yunji City was built halfway up a mountain, with only one main road leading inside. Although this road was built wide and flat, allowing countless people to walk side by side, it...
...was winding and spiraling!
Like a giant dragon, its head lay at the gates of Yunji City, and its tail rested at the foot of the mountain.
If the twenty thousand Imperial Guards wanted to attack the city, they would have to charge upwards from below. This was extremely disadvantageous, even a major taboo in military strategy!
But Yunji City was designed exactly to force any invading enemy into this strategic trap.
Just as he was thinking this, he saw the twenty thousand Imperial Guards suddenly stop and set up camp right below Yunji City, making no further moves.
Soon after, a unit of about twenty armored cavalrymen, led by a person fully clad in golden armor and wearing a golden helmet, all riding snow-white warhorses with hooves flying, headed straight for the base of Yunji City.
"General, I'm afraid they are here to negotiate."
Sun Xiang, being experienced and knowledgeable, immediately said.
Yunji City was easy to defend and hard to attack. No matter how formidable the combat power of the twenty thousand Imperial Guards was, trying to take a prepared Yunji City was wishful thinking.
At best, the result would be mutual destruction.
Moreover, the casualties of the Imperial Guard would be far higher than those of the Yunji City defenders.
Ren Tianye also nodded and said, "Since they are here to negotiate, let's talk. Anyway..."
"We are not in a hurry."
Sun Xiang knew what Ren Tianye meant: the plan to hold their ground, quietly wait for the world to fall into chaos, and then seize the opportunity to strike.
He settled his mind and waited for the approaching general.
In just a short moment, those twenty or so people arrived below the city gate tower. They directly crossed the moat, making absolutely no defensive preparations.
Their calm and composed posture gave the people of Yunji City a feeling of arrogance.
The crowd also saw clearly that the leader was a young man in golden armor, with a face as flawless as jade, thick eyebrows slanting into his hairline, and the corners of his eyes slightly tilted upwards, carrying a hint of frivolous scrutiny.
He truly had a handsome appearance.
A deputy general beside him immediately shouted, "Who gave you the nerve to block my Young Duke? Open the city gates at once!"
Open the city gates?
The few people on the wall were taken aback again.
"Wait, why are they telling us to open the gates? Do they want to come in to negotiate?"
"Looks like it. Isn't this too bold? Facing rebels like us, they dare to directly enter our territory to negotiate? Have they eaten a bear's heart and a leopard's gall?"
"Great General, what do you think?"
...
